Science Curriculum Aims

Curriculum Objectives

The Primary Science curriculum is designed to enable students to:

  • Cultivate curiosity and interest in the world of science, fostering a foundation for lifelong learning.
  • Develop scientific inquiry and problem-solving skills, mastering fundamental scientific knowledge, process skills, and generic capabilities.
  • Synthesize and apply knowledge and skills across science and related disciplines, gaining an initial understanding of the nature of science while communicating scientific ideas through basic scientific language.
  • Conduct rational analysis and reasoning based on data and logic to form independent insights, while developing introductory engineering mindsets and practical skills.
  • Recognize the impact of science on society, ethics, the environment, and technology, fostering a responsible civic attitude committed to personal and community well-being.
  • Promote self-directed learning to become lifelong learners in science, facilitating continuous personal development.
  • Prepare for advanced scientific studies at the secondary level and potential future careers in scientific and technological sectors.

 

Learning Objectives  

We aspire for our students to achieve the following:

  • Mastery of Foundational Knowledge: Acquire basic scientific knowledge and understand common scientific phenomena, facts, patterns, concepts, and principles encountered in daily life.
  • Scientific Inquiry and Knowledge Construction: Learn to utilize scientific methods for inquiry and knowledge building, and become proficient in using simple scientific terminology and modes of expression.
  • Practical Application: Apply scientific knowledge and technological products to solve simple problems in everyday contexts.
  • Evidence-Based Judgment: Make informed and judicious decisions based on factual evidence and scientific data.
  • Design and Investigation: Plan and conduct simple scientific investigations, including observation, measurement, data recording, and reporting. Students should be able to provide simple explanations or reasonable inferences based on results while reflecting on the inquiry process.
  • Values and Attitudes: Uphold a rational and objective mindset characterized by a spirit of seeking truth. Students are encouraged to maintain a persistent curiosity in science and technology, alongside a profound respect and care for all life and the environment.
